Hi friends! If you think I told you about all my hiking, then you are mistaken. Today I want to share with you my memories of a summer hike in 2017 where I went with my friends. Then we decided to lay our trekking route through the Gorgani mountain range, which is part of the Ukrainian Carpathians. To be precise, we did not visit all the peaks of Gorgany, only climbed two mountains - Khomyak and Synyak, but let's get everything in order.

The first step of our hike was the ascent to the polonyna (mountain plain) Khomyak . Given that our hike was in the middle of the summer, the day of the climb seemed very hot. Despite the fact that the climb itself took place mainly in the woods, under the tree canopy, we were all very tired, our t-shirts were completely wet with sweat already in the middle of the climb. I will not fail to say that the ascent of the mountain valley was more difficult than the future two ascents of the mountain Khomyak and Synyak.

When we rested a bit, we were able to enjoy the beautiful scenery around. What is known as alpine meadows abroad is traditionally called polonynas in Ukrain - mountain pastures. Cows with cute rattles on their necks graze here. The interest of tourists is concentrated to the huts, where shepherds live in the spring and throughout the summer, changing each other. They feed cows and sheep, make cheese, brynza. We also met a herd of cows on our way and took some pictures.
